    The Moving Average Cheat Sheet for Forex Trading Strategies for Beginners

    Staring at a live forex chart for the first time can feel like trying to read a heart rate monitor in the middle of a major earthquake. Prices bounce up and down in jagged lines, making it incredibly difficult to tell where the market is actually going. To make sense of this chaos, beginners need a reliable tool to smooth out the noise and reveal the true underlying trend.

    What actually is a moving average, and why should I care?

    Think of a moving average (MA) as a visual dampener for price volatility. If you look at raw, minute-by-minute price movements, you will see a lot of random zig-zagging that doesn’t mean much. By averaging out the price over a set number of past periods—say, the last 50 or 100 days—the moving average creates a smooth, continuous line that follows the market.

    It is highly comparable to a weather forecast. If you only look at today’s temperature, a sudden cold front might make you think winter has arrived in July. But if you look at the 14-day average temperature, you get a much clearer picture of the actual season. In forex, this indicator helps you see past temporary price spikes so you can trade in the direction of the dominant trend.

    What is the difference between an SMA and an EMA?

    You will constantly hear traders argue about Simple Moving Averages (SMA) and Exponential Moving Averages (EMA). The difference lies entirely in how they calculate their data. An SMA treats every single day in its period with equal weight. For example, a 50-day SMA simply adds up the last 50 closing prices and divides them by 50.

    An EMA, on the other hand, acts more like a “what have you done for me lately” indicator. It places much more mathematical weight on the most recent candles. Because of this calculation, the EMA reacts much faster to sudden price turnarounds. While this responsiveness is great for fast-paced markets, the trade-off is that it can occasionally trick you with false signals, whereas the slower SMA keeps you grounded in the long-term trend.

    Which periods are the best for a beginner to use?

    You do not need to invent crazy, custom numbers. The global trading community has already agreed on a few standard settings, and using them is incredibly smart because it means you are looking at the exact same key levels as the institutional players.

    For short-term momentum, look at the 9-period or 21-period EMAs. If you want to identify medium-term trends and find solid entry pullbacks, the 50-period SMA is your absolute go-to tool. Finally, the legendary 200-period SMA is the ultimate line in the sand. When the price is above the 200 SMA, the market is in a macro uptrend; when it sits below, the bears are firmly in control of the playing field.

    How do I use these lines to build simple trading strategies?

    One of the most popular, time-tested methods for beginners is the moving average crossover strategy. For this setup, you place two different averages on your chart—a fast-moving one (like a 9 EMA) and a slow-moving one (like a 21 EMA).

    When the fast line crosses above the slow line, it signals that upward momentum is accelerating, suggesting a potential buy. If the fast line crosses below the slow line, it warns you that sellers are taking over, pointing to a sell. It gives you a highly visual, rules-based entry system that completely removes the guesswork from your day.

    Is there a catch? Why doesn’t this indicator work perfectly all the time?

    Moving averages are “lagging” indicators, meaning they are built entirely on historical data. They tell you what the market has done, not what it will do next. Because of this delay, you will always enter a trend slightly after it has already started.

    These lines work brilliantly when the market is strongly trending in one clear direction. However, if the market starts moving sideways in a flat range, the moving average line will flatten out, and your crossover signals will start crossing back and forth rapidly, creating a series of small, frustrating losses. Understanding how these indicators behave is a vital part of forex trading strategies for beginners because it teaches you to stay on the sidelines when the market lacks a clear trend.

    Summary

    Moving averages are not crystal balls, but they are incredibly powerful tools for structuring your market analysis. Keep your charts clean, stick to the widely respected periods like the 50 and 200 SMAs, and always combine your indicator signals with solid risk management. By using these smooth lines to guide your decisions, you protect your trading account from the emotional chaos of trading blind.
